October 22 – Thriving in the Desert

The vast, arid expanse of the Gibber Plains appears lifeless at first glance, with its red, rocky terrain stretching endlessly. Yet, this seemingly barren landscape holds a remarkable secret: life thrives after rain. The parched earth transforms into a vibrant tapestry of short-lived herbfields, with resilient ephemeral grasses, hardy saltbush, and delicate daisies. These plants spring forth quickly, seizing the brief window of moisture.

In our spiritual journey, we too encounter seasons of dryness, when our faith feels distant and parched. It’s during these times that we must remember God’s word as our constant refuge and hope. Just as the Gibber Plains reveal hidden life after rain, our spiritual growth often occurs through adversity. By anchoring ourselves in the wisdom of sacred texts and trusting in Divine providence, we cultivate resilience to weather any challenge, knowing that new life and growth will emerge from even the most barren of circumstances.
